Which of the following statements is correct?
Income and expenditure relating to special funds should not be dealt with in the income and expenditure account.
The correct answer is option 3. Income and expenditure relating to special funds should not be dealt with in the income and expenditure account because these transactions are related to a specific fund and should be recorded separately to ensure clarity and proper accounting for restricted funds. The other options are incorrect: the income and expenditure account is a nominal account, not a real account; receipts and payments include both capital and revenue receipts, not just capital receipts; and honorarium payments are generally considered revenue expenditure, not capital expenditure.
